**Q: How does Textgrove detect encoding on uploaded files?**

A: We sniff the first 8 KB — BOM first, then a confidence-scored heuristic, falling back to UTF-8 strict. Anything ambiguous gets quarantined rather than guessed, so no mojibake sneaks into downstream parsers. Quarantine review is gated; to open a held file you'll need the recovery passphrase listed below.

vault phrase of bagaf-kajeg = jorath-feniel-briir-siliel-ralix

Ticket: export worker dropping connections

Hey, the Cobblewick spreadsheet exporter keeps ballooning past its memory limit on big exports, and when the OOM killer takes it down, pooled connections die mid-query, so users see connection failures. Bump the worker limit as a stopgap. To check for orphaned sessions, connect with the string below.

primary connection of yagep-kahip = redis://giliel_svc:zYiKsLL2PLpfPL@db-348f.xolmarsys.corp:5432/fenwyn

Hello plugin authors,

Next Thursday, Corbexa will run a disaster-recovery drill for the RestockRoute vending-machine restock planner. During the failover window, plugin callbacks will be replayed against the standby scheduler, so please ensure your handlers are idempotent and tolerate duplicate route assignments. No customer restock data will be altered. To re-register your plugin against the standby environment during the drill, authenticate with the recovery passphrase provided below.

vault phrase of hahip-tajeg = quenax-briath-briax

Visitor policy update for night shift: the Dorlan-fitted door sensors on the east entrance of the Kestrel Annex are subject to a manufacturer recall and have been disabled until replacements arrive. Visitors after 22:00 must be escorted through the main lobby only. Log each entry in the night register as usual. To open the lobby inner door manually, use the override code below.

door code, yagap-bahof: bdg-O-05

TICKET-4471 — Cron drift on Marrowjet batch host

Nightly jobs fired 11 minutes late across three runs. Root cause: staging env file shipped to prod with `MJ_CRON_TZ` unset, so the scheduler fell back to host time. Fix: set `MJ_CRON_TZ=UTC` in the prod env file and restart the scheduler. The scheduler's auth secret goes on the line directly after it:

vault entry, yahif-yajep: COURIER_KEY29=b802bdf8034096b65a51c6ba5abe2